NAPA Tracs customers can now use Bolt On Technology’s suite of add-on automotive software.
Mike Risich, Bolt On Technology chief technology officer, said that customers have seen average repair orders increase 45-75% with Bolt On’s software and the company expects the same for shops using the NAPA Tracs system.
Bolt On Technology products that fully integrate with Napa Tracs include the Pro Pack, Mobile Manager Pro, Pro Call and Quick Change Pro.
The Pro Pack includes three software modules that can analyze a vehicle’s driving history and predict when a customer should return for routine services, send out a text message appointment reminder, and allow shops to customize invoices to include a shop’s logo.
The Mobile Manager Pro is an Android mobile device powered add-on software solution that can help increase shop efficiency through digital inspections and repair orders, the company said.
Pro Call is a program that acts as the automotive repair shop’s “caller ID.” The program also allows stores to discover additional data related to the customer’s spending habits at the shop, the vehicles and when services are due, the company said.
Quick Charge Pro helps shops safely and securely process credit cards and helps the shop email a copy of the transaction to customers, according to the company.
